Utilization of a computerized system at the pharmacy department of the University of Tokyo Hospital--impact of prescription order entry and computerized dispensing system.

作者信息

Tsubaki T, Orii T, Sugiura M

机构信息

Hospital Pharmacy, Faculty of Medicine, University of Tokyo.

出版信息

Jpn Hosp. 1990 Jul;9:61-7.

Abstract

(1) A medication order entry system, (2) a fully automatic tablet counting and packaging machine connected with a medication order entry system, and (3) a check system for one dose package developed and implemented in the University of Tokyo Hospital are described. The principal objectives of these systems are (1) to reduce medication errors and the clerical workload of staff, (2) to make more efficient use of staff, (3) to provide staff with sufficient drug information for patient drug therapy. We compared computerized systems (post-computerization) and traditional multi-dose dispensing systems (pre-computerization) by analyzing inquiry rate and dispensing time in the pharmacy for inpatients. Inquiry rate was 23.0% and 2.6% for pre-computerization and post-computerization, respectively. Total dispensing time per patient was 207 seconds and 147 seconds for pre-computerization and post-computerization, respectively. Implementation of the computerized systems helped significantly in decreasing inquiry rate and time needed to complete the dispensing process when compared with a traditional dispensing system. Implementation of the computerized systems was very useful for physicians, pharmacists, and nurses in conducting drug therapy.

摘要

介绍了东京大学医院开发并实施的(1)医嘱录入系统、(2)与医嘱录入系统相连的全自动片剂计数及包装机,以及(3)单剂量包装检查系统。这些系统的主要目标是:(1)减少用药错误和工作人员的文书工作量;(2)更高效地利用工作人员;(3)为工作人员提供足够的患者药物治疗用药信息。我们通过分析住院患者药房的查询率和配药时间,对计算机化系统(计算机化后)和传统多剂量配药系统(计算机化前)进行了比较。计算机化前和计算机化后的查询率分别为23.0%和2.6%。每位患者的总配药时间,计算机化前和计算机化后分别为207秒和147秒。与传统配药系统相比,计算机化系统的实施在显著降低查询率和完成配药过程所需时间方面有帮助。计算机化系统的实施对医生、药剂师和护士进行药物治疗非常有用。
